MONT CHALET in the 1st Dark Sky Reserve 🌠

Mont Chalet is located in Estrie in the small village of La Patrie. About fifteen minutes from Mont-Mégantic National Park. This cottage WITHOUT electricity, offers you the desired comfort by being totally independent. Wood heating, refrigerator, stove and hot water are functional with propane gas and lights thanks to 12 volt batteries. Skiing, snowshoeing and walking are possible on this 270-acre land. One visit and you'll be charmed. Come and admire the starry sky 🌟
